The first 1000/8 Takumar lens was not a telephoto design. It was a long focus design. i.e. the lens is 1000mm long. Telephoto designs have barrels signifigantly SHORTER than the focal length. the telephoto takumar 1000/8 lenses are only 720mm long. JCO
